Thoughtworks Moogsoft is an AIOps platform that applies machine learning to IT event data, reducing alert noise and surfacing actionable incidents for operations teams. It targets mid-to-large enterprise NOC, ITOps, and SRE teams overwhelmed by raw alert volume from complex multi-tool monitoring stacks. A free tier is available, the Team plan costs $833 per month with unlimited users, and Enterprise pricing is quote-based. Key capabilities include AI-powered anomaly detection, situation-based event correlation, automated root cause analysis, and a workflow engine, plus single pane of glass observability, an open API, and 50-plus integrations covering Datadog, Splunk, ServiceNow, and Jira. In practice, Moogsoft ingests alerts and events from across an IT environment and uses AI-driven correlation to group related signals into a smaller set of actionable situations. Operators work from these consolidated incidents rather than raw alert streams, reducing the manual triage burden and accelerating response times.
The platform's highlighted differentiators include its anomaly detection algorithms, which the product positions as industry-leading, and its automated noise reduction capabilities. These features are designed to filter out irrelevant or redundant alerts before they reach on-call engineers, allowing teams to focus on genuine service degradations.
Moogsoft targets IT operations, SRE, and NOC teams at mid-to-large enterprises managing complex, high-volume alert environments. It competes in the AIOps category alongside products such as PagerDuty, BigPanda, Splunk ITSI, and ServiceNow Event Management. Uses machine learning algorithms with adaptive thresholds and pattern recognition to continuously monitor IT systems and identify deviations from normal behavior that could signal potential incidents.
Makes alert relatedness decisions based on NLP rather than static rules or topology, enabling more intelligent and context-aware grouping of incidents.
Groups related alerts and anomalies from disparate systems into coherent 'Situations' using patented machine learning algorithms that identify relationships between seemingly unrelated events.
Employs advanced analytics and historical time-series data to automatically pinpoint the root cause of complex incidents, dramatically reducing manual troubleshooting time.
Analyzes historical trends and patterns to forecast potential infrastructure failures before they occur, enabling proactive maintenance scheduling to maintain continuous service availability.
A configurable workflow engine that lets users process monitoring data with sequences of actions to ingest, enrich, automate, ticket, and collaborate across incident response workflows.
Offers a virtual Network Operations Center (NOC) Situation Room where teams can collaborate throughout the incident management lifecycle regardless of physical location, with integrated ChatOps support.
Automatically applies statistical calculations and noise-reduction algorithms to deduplicate and filter incoming alerts, reducing operational alert volumes by up to 99% while keeping critical issues visible.
Enriches ingested alert data with key contextual metadata such as location, department, business criticality, service relationships, runbook references, and escalation processes.
Aggregates cross-source data from monitoring tools, logs, metrics, and ticketing systems into a unified view so teams do not have to navigate multiple interfaces to synthesize operational information.
Provides a REST API, webhooks, and a 'Create Your Own Integration' feature enabling custom connectivity with over 50 out-of-the-box tools including ServiceNow, Splunk, AppDynamics, New Relic, and Jira.
Integrates security throughout the software development lifecycle with strong encryption for data at rest and in transit, and supports comprehensive authentication methods including Single Sign-On (SSO).

Team tier: $833/month billed annually, $9,996/year. Unlimited users — no seat tax. That's rare and genuinely good math for a 50-person NOC team. Free tier exists: 3 users, 500K metrics, basic correlation. Useful for a proof of concept, not production. Compare to PagerDuty, which charges per user and layers on AIOps features at additional cost. Moogsoft's flat-user model wins on paper.
Enterprise pricing: contact sales. No published rate. The evidence lists Enterprise as '$0.00' — a data artifact, not a deal. 200K events plus 20M metrics is the stated ceiling, but overage rates aren't published anywhere. That's where the invoice surprises live. Year-3 TCO is genuinely unknowable without a contract in hand.
